@Guru, You can beat Stocksmaster without bursting your chest and carrying your heart in a bucket of cold water.Besides trading just about any other stock (You must be a fire fighter),you've made Kshs 70,589.How has the moni been shared?...Your take is Kshs 33,169 while your broker has so far pocketed Kshs 37,420......I now know why brokers need not own stocks....lol.
